Block
#12,707,804
29w
9 txs886,808 confs
Transactions
9
Total Output
₳3,080,715.54
$455.54K
Fees
₳1.54
Size
2.85 KB
2,922 bytes
Details
Hash
2cdd1687ab0db98d997852007752c8076cf562ab9d688bca0ccba3d4cf64e884
Epoch / Slot
Epoch 597 · slot 172,777,289 · epoch-slot 236,489
Timestamp
29w · Fri, 28 Nov 2025 15:26:20 GMT
Block producer
VRF key
vrf_vk1d…xs3mxmm2
Op cert
fe69762e…19bccf2b
Op cert counter
22